Frame Repair

To ensure energy efficiency window frames should be in good condition to support the glass and seal the airtight spaces between the panes. They are also susceptible to damage through wear and weather and require repair or replacement. Window frame repairs vary between $150 and $600 on average. It involves removing the old putty, caulk, and paint from the frame and replacing it with new materials. They also include setting the windows and tightening the rest of the hardware.

The replacement of window hinges costs between $75 and $200 dollars. This includes all components and labor. Window hinges are used to support the weight of the sash as it is closed and opens, and they help keep the window in its place and secure. Because of time and use they may wear out, broken, or misaligned.

A window sash can be a moveable panel that is used to hang windows and must be replaced to maintain the airtight seal between windows. Window sash costs range from $250 to $600, based on the kind and size of sash. Window sash replacement is more expensive than glass replacement, as the new sash needs to be sized to match the frame that is currently in use.

double glazed window repair-pane windows are often used in extreme weather conditions to provide insulation, but they can be damaged by storms and the use of. The seals may break, leading to condensation between the panes of glass and reducing the efficiency of energy. Double-paned windows need to be repaired as soon as they can if they are damaged.

Double-pane windows repair costs are priced between $300 and $880 per glass pane. The process of repair may include removing the broken window glass, repairing or changing the frame, and re-installing the sealing material. Misted Window Repair

Many homeowners choose double-glazed windows due to their energy-saving capabilities. They also help maintain an ideal temperature. However, they're not impervious to damage and may suffer damage that requires repair. The misting of windows is caused by condensation that forms between the glass panes. It may not seem like an issue however it can cause serious damage to the appearance and function of your home.

A break in the seal is the reason of misty windows. This allows moisture in the insulation layer, reducing its effectiveness and causing fogging. While this may not seem like a major problem, it's vital to have it repaired immediately.

A misty window is not just unattractive, but can cause your property to lose value. It also blocks natural light and reduces visibility which makes your home appear less appealing and darker. Additionally, it may affect the efficiency of your home, and also increase the cost of cooling or heating.

The best method to avoid the window from becoming cloudy is to ensure the frame and seal are in good shape. Regular maintenance by experts will keep the seals and the glass in good condition. If you notice signs of condensation, it's crucial to get in touch with a professional to complete double glazing window repairs immediately.

During double glazing window repair-glazing the gap between two glass panes is filled up with an inert gas like Krypton or argon, which hinders the flow of heat. This helps to create a more insulated interior for your house, but it may cause misting if the seal breaks.

A window specialist can fix the seal that is damaged by drilling holes in the unit and inserting drying agents. This is a more cost-effective alternative to replacing the entire unit, however it may not be as long-lasting or efficient. In certain instances, it might be necessary to replace the entire unit in order to avoid a repeat of the problem.
